








Novi Sad is a city located in the northern part of Serbia, on the banks of the Danube River. With the second-largest population in the country, Novi Sad is an important cultural, economic, and educational center.
The city is known for its numerous landmarks, and one of the most famous is the Petrovaradin Fortress. This magnificent fortress was built in the 18th century and offers a spectacular view of the city and the Danube River. Every year in July, the fortress hosts the Exit Festival, one of the largest music festivals in Europe.
Novi Sad is also renowned for its picturesque old town, which is abundant in beautiful architecture, charming streets, and squares. The main square in Novi Sad, Liberty Square, is surrounded by significant buildings such as the City Hall and the Catholic Cathedral. Here you can also find the most famous symbol of the city, the Clock Tower, which dominates the city skyline.
Novi Sad is also an important cultural center. The city is home to numerous museums, galleries, and theaters. Among the most famous are the Vojvodina Museum, the Museum of Contemporary Art of Vojvodina, and the Serbian National Theatre.
The residents of Novi Sad are known for their hospitality and open-mindedness. The city is multicultural, with different ethnic and religious communities living together in harmony.
Novi Sad also has a vibrant student life. The University of Novi Sad is one of the most respected universities in Serbia and attracts students from all over the world.
With its rich history, culture, and natural beauty, Novi Sad is a city that offers many opportunities for exploration and enjoyment.
